Understanding Concrete Weight Coating

Concrete weight coating serves as a protective layer applied to pipeline systems, primarily those located underwater or in challenging terrains. Its dual function of providing weight and protection helps mitigate buoyancy issues and environmental damage.

Benefits of Concrete Weight Coating

  • Buoyancy Management: Prevents pipelines from floating, ensuring they remain submerged.
  • Corrosion Resistance: Offers a barrier against environmental factors, extending the lifespan of the pipes.
  • Impact Protection: Shields against external impacts during installation and service.

Real-World Applications

A notable instance is the Nord Stream Pipeline project, which used concrete weight coating extensively. This approach enhanced stability in the Baltic Sea, reducing the risk of buoyancy and ensuring a successful installation.

Common Challenges Addressed by Concrete Weight Coating

  1. Environmental Factors: Coating mitigates risks posed by currents and marine life.
  2. Hydrodynamic Forces: Provides stability against the forces exerted by water currents.
  3. Installation Risks: Reduces the potential for pipes to become misaligned during installation.

Considerations When Choosing Coating Options

When selecting a concrete weight coating, focus on factors such as environmental conditions, pipeline diameter, and installation methods. Tailoring the coating to specific project needs can enhance effectiveness and durability.
